Concrete Foundation Repair in Columbus, OH
Concrete fo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a property's foundation. These services typically involve assessing and fixing problems such as cracks, settling, shifting, or unevenness in the foundation structure. Projects can range from small crack repairs in basement walls to large-scale underpinning for settling slabs or sinking foundations. Homeowners often seek foundation repair when noticing signs like uneven floors, gaps around doors and windows, or visible cracks, aiming to prevent further damage and maintain the safety of their property.
Before requesting foundation rep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the underlying causes, and the best solutions for their specific situation. It’s important to consider factors like soil conditions, previous foundation issues, and the age of the property. Clear communication about the scope of work, potential costs, and the benefits of repairs can help homeowners make informed decisions to protect their investment and ensure the long-term stability of their home.

Common Concrete Foundation Repair Jobs
Cracked or shifting concrete - addressing uneven or damaged foundations to restore stability.
Basement foundation repair - fixing bowing walls or leaks to prevent further structural issues.
Slab foundation repair - stabilizing sinking or settling slabs for improved safety and durability.
Pier and beam foundation repair - reinforcing or replacing support systems to prevent sagging or tilting.
Foundation leveling - correcting uneven floors and cracks caused by ground movement.
Structural reinforcement - strengthening weak or compromised foundations to support the property securely.
Concrete Foundation Repair Questions
What signs indicate a need for foundation repair? C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ick may suggest foundation issues requiring attention.
What types of foundation problems are common in Columbus, OH? Common issues include settling, cracking, and shifting caused by soil movement and moisture changes.
How does foundation damage affect property value? Significant foundation issues can decrease property value and may complicate future sale or refinancing efforts.
What are typical causes of foundation damage? Causes include soil settlement, water infiltration, poor drainage, and tree roots exerting pressure on the foundation.
